Galaxy M30 has an overall score of 82.4, which is just a bit better than Moto G51 5G's score of 77.8. These phones work with Android OS (Operating System), but Galaxy M30 has a more recent 9.0 Pie version and Moto G51 5G has Android 11 version. Although Galaxy M30 is way older than Moto G51 5G, it's construction is somewhat lighter and just a little thinner.
Galaxy M30 has a screen that's just as good as the Moto G51 5G one, because although the Galaxy M30 has a quite lower resolution of 1080 x 2280px and a quite smaller display, it also counts with a little bit more pixels per inch of screen. Samsung Galaxy M30 features a very superior memory capacity for apps and games than Moto G51 5G, and although they both have a SD extension slot that allows a maximum of 512 GB, the Samsung Galaxy M30 also has 128 GB internal storage capacity.
Moto G51 5G counts with just a bit better hardware performance than Galaxy M30, although it has a smaller amount of RAM memory, they both have 8 cpu cores. Moto G51 5G captures way better pictures and videos than Samsung Galaxy M30, and although they both have the same 1920x1080 video resolution, the Moto G51 5G also has higher video frame rates, a bigger aperture to take better low-light photos and a lot more mega-pixels camera.
The Moto G51 5G and the Samsung Galaxy M30 have very similar batteries.
